Victor Massey;73;of 510 Third street;Monessen;died at his home;Saturday;February 24;1956;at 8:10 p.m. Mr.Massey was employed in the blast furnace department of Pittsburgh Steel company in Monessen until 1925;and then operated Massey’s Confectionery at Third street;Monessen;until 1951. He then became steward of the Franco-Belgium club;and in 1954;retired from this position. He was a charter member of the Franco-Belgium club. He is survived by his wife;Augustine Guibourdanche Massey;one son;Gustave;of Monessen;a brother;Herman of Monessen;two sisters;Mrs.Lewis (Louise) Morreau and Emily Massey;both of Monessen. Friends will be received at the Edwin Melenyzer Funeral Home during hours of 1 to 5 and 7 to 10 p.m. Services will be held there Wednesday;February 29;1956;at 2 p.m.;and interment will follow in Belle Vernon Cemetery. Edwin Melenyzer is the funeral director.
